Zazzle is an American online marketplace that allows designers and customers to create their own products with independent manufacturers (clothing, posters, etc.), as well as use images from participating companies.     Friends is an American television sitcom created by David Crane and Marta Kauffman, which aired on NBC from September 22, 1994, to May 6, 2004, lasting ten seasons. With an ensemble cast starring Jennifer Aniston, Courteney Cox, Lisa Kudrow, Matt LeBlanc, Matthew Perry and David Schwimmer, the show revolves around six friends in their 20s and early 30s who live in Manhattan, New York City.

Fox first announced for a local adaptation of I Can See Your Voice during the Television Critics Association January 2020 press tour, with Ken Jeong (who serves as a panelist on The Masked Singer, a local adaptation of another South Korean program) hosting the pilot episode; this was acquired by Fox for the rights to produce the said show a month later.

    April 13, 1972. ( 1972-04-13) My Three Sons is an American television sitcom that aired from September 29, 1960, to April 13, 1972. The series was broadcast on ABC during its first five seasons, before moving to CBS for the remaining seven seasons.     Zazie Olivia Beetz (/ z ə ˈ s iː ˈ b eɪ t s / zə-SEE BAYTS; German: [zaˈsiː ˈbeːts]; born June 1, 1991) is a German-born American actress. She is best known for her role in the FX comedy-drama series Atlanta (2016–2022), for which she received a nomination for the Primetime Emmy Award for Outstanding Supporting Actress in a Comedy Series.
